I Need Help
I don't know why he keeps trying to bite me? I just got him and one day I openned up the screen to get him...He knew I was there. he just bit me! Should I be getting him from behind? He seems to be very jittery...The girl I got him from said he was handled alot and are used getting handle and has never biten. I am thinking otherwise... Today, I put his water bowl in for him and he tried to bite me again! What am I doing wrong?

Re: I Need Help
i recently replied to a message you sent me about this so definitely answer some quetions.
how long have you had him? what is your enclosure set up like (temps, etc)? what do you feed him and how often? if you haven't had him for that long I would say he's stressed and still getting used to environment changes. also, is he in a room of your house that has alot of activity going on? that might scare him if he's not settled in.

Re: I Need Help
if he's on one side of the tank all the time I would say the tank's ambient air temp should be a bit higher, he should be regulating his temps, also im not sure what snake your talking about, but a 10 seems a bit cramped, not to mention its tough to make a decent thermogradient in a 10. As for biting, i agree probaly just a bit stressed. I would let him calm down, give him time, as for your approach to handling him, the idea is that he shouldn't see you as a threat or food, so trying to trick him by grabbing from behind in my opinion is not the best idea.

Re: I Need Help
When I get a new pet and they seem stressed out or aggressive, I try to put them in a quite place, only checking on the temp, water and cleanliness of the cage. I even go without feeding them for a couple of weeks, unless they are a very very young snake.
When they bite me I use cold running water and they let go. I have a Rosy that just latches on and wont let go. The cold water gets them to let go. I never use hot water or any type of alcohol. I bet the little guy is comepletey stressed out. I would also watch him very closely and keep records, he may be trying to communicate something with you. I always accept my just the way they are. Also try genlty putting a cloth over him when picking him up or using gloves. That works for me when I am working with them in the beggining. Glad to see he is eating in a seperate container since he has substrate as not to cause obstruction and frozen thawed. Hope things work out. Just remember, to listen to thier communication. |
